Re: [Networker] translating acsls device to operating systems device names
2007-11-21 12:17:53
You can have hints by using under ACSLS prompt :
display drive *,*,*,* -f type serial_num
With serial number, position and type of each drive, it will be easier.
You have the command inquire (by Legato) which tells you the serial number and
the WW[P/N]N of a zoned drive.
You have tools with libraries like SLConsole (works with STK SL8500 ...)

Vernon Harris writes:
> Is there an acsls command or networker command that can show > the
> operating system device name for the tape drives, ie crossreference > a
> particular os device name to a acsls device name?
not that i found. the least brain-taxing method i found was to tell acsls to
load a tape into a particular drive then issue something like
mt -f /dev/rmt/0cn stat
to see which drive the tape had magically appeared in.
eject tape, then repeat procedure for all tape drives.
maybe there's a better way, but this was easy and it worked.
